Strawberry Chocolate Bars with Coconut

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 1/2 cup r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ened shredded coconut
  • 3 tbsp maple syrup
  • 2 tbsp coconut oil (room temperature)
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ries (finely diced)
  • 454 g silken tofu (drained)
  • 1/3 cup maple syrup
  • 1/4 cup raw cacao powder
  • 3 tbsp corn starch
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line an 8×8 ba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ine 1 cup almond flour, 1/2 cup rolled oats, 1/2 cup unsweetened shredded coconut, 3 tbsp maple syrup, and 2 tbsp room temperature coconut oil. Mix until crumbly and press into the bottom of the prepared baking sheet.
  3. In a blender, combine 454 g silken tofu, 1 cup finely diced strawberries, 1/3 cup maple syrup, 1/4 cup raw cacao powder, 3 tbsp corn starch, and 1 tsp vanilla extract. Blend until smooth.
  4. Pour the filling over the crust and spread evenly. Bake for about 32 minutes or until set.
  5. Allow to cool completely before slicing into squares.
